ResponsibilitiesAccountable for driving achievement of project milestones from study start?up through to delivery of the database and monitoring of time spent on tasks.Provide Database Programming input into protocol data collection assessments.Create the annotated CRF (aCRF) using company standards or Sponsor's naming conventions in accordance with relevant company procedures.Accountable for building the clinical database, creating variables, codelists, forms and visits in accordance with the aCRF.Develop the computerized checks in accordance with the Data Validation Plan.Develop SAS checks in accordance with the Data Validation Plan.Implement mid?study changes to the production eCRF when requested by the Lead DM.Communicate the database setup status and the achievement of milestones to the Lead DM.Create and validate import programs of electronic data received from external vendors.Import electronic data received from external vendors during the course of the clinical study.Program and validate data listings (e.G., Manual checks, Medical Review listings, Coding report, etc.).
Program and validate tracking or metric reports.Plan and prioritise work and take appropriate actions (e.G., escalation).
Contribute in formal training for new database programming staff.Apply SOPs and guidance documents as well as applicable industry standards such as ICH, GCP, etc. to day?to?day activities and generate all required documentation for study files.Lead the DBP team, coordinate other DBP staff, provide direction regarding work assignment, scheduling and prioritizing,
and monitor progress of activities.Maintain continuous and appropriate communication with Lead DM and/or study Project Manager and share critical and general issues.Develop and maintain a network of contacts within the study team.Make recommendations for database setup process improvements and development of new standards.Input into and monitor progress against study project plan and escalates issues to resolution at the appropriate level.Prove ability to analyse data capture problems/opportunities and deliver high?quality solutions.Demonstrate broad and integrated knowledge of all aspects of Database Programming, providing consultancy to other groups outside DBP.Educate/train on use of study?specific data collection tool(s).
Represent Database Programming in internal or external meetings (e.G., EDC demos).
Conduct other activities as required.QualificationsDegree (preferably in Computer Science) or at least 6 years of experience in database programming or a similar role within a pharmaceutical environment or equivalent.Knowledge of Alira Health systems.Very good knowledge of Data Management processes and pharmaceutical industry guidelines such as ICH, GCP, etc.Expert knowledge in one or more clinical data management systems and recognized for expertise (e.G., Medidata Rave, Merative Zelta).
